Minneapolis residents face unique challenges: blended families, aging parents, and evolving household structures. A will appoints guardians for minor children, names an executor to manage affairs, and directs asset distribution with precision. Over 55% of Americans lack an up-to-date will, leaving heirs to navigate probate without guidance. You can avoid that outcome with a document tailored to your current circumstances.
Local courts enforce wills that meet Minnesota's statutory formalities—signature, witnesses, and testamentary intent. Mistakes in drafting or execution can invalidate the entire document, triggering disputes and delays. Minneapolis Families and Estate Planning Realities
Minneapolis neighborhoods span historic homes near the lakes and new condos downtown, each with distinct planning needs. Wills address real estate, retirement accounts, personal property, and digital assets. If you own a home in the city or suburbs, naming beneficiaries and an executor protects heirs from unnecessary legal costs and confusion.
Blended families and second marriages add complexity. A will clarifies who inherits what, reducing conflict among stepchildren, ex-spouses, and biological heirs. Minnesota law allows you to disinherit certain relatives—if your will states that intent explicitly. Without clear language, courts may apply default rules that contradict your goals.
